Kim Kardashian Walks the 2026 Met Gala Red Carpet Alone

The 2026 Met Gala, held tonight at The Metropolitan Museum of Art in New York City, delivered the usual parade of high-fashion spectacle. Yet one of the most anticipated arrivals never materialized. Kim Kardashian, a perennial fixture of the event since 2013, stepped onto the carpet alone. Her boyfriend, seven-time Formula 1 World Champion Lewis Hamilton, was notably absent.

Kardashian wore a striking bronze breastplate, designed in collaboration with artist Alan Jones. The piece was molded from a model from the 1960s and featured an open skirt, aligning with this year’s “Costume Art” theme and dress code “Fashion Is Art.” Despite months of speculation about a joint appearance, the reality star posed for photographers on her own, leaving her red carpet debut with Hamilton for another night.

The couple first sparked dating rumors at the beginning of 2026. While fans and media have eagerly watched for them to confirm their relationship with a public appearance at fashion’s biggest night, the Met Gala was not that moment. According to multiple sources, Hamilton did not accompany Kardashian to the event, keeping their relationship status under wraps for now.

The F1 Star’s History at the Met Gala

Hamilton is no stranger to the Met Gala. He co-chaired the 2025 edition, which celebrated the “Superfine: Tailoring Black Style” exhibit. That year, he wore a layered white suit by Grace Wales Bonner, a look rich with cultural meaning. In previous years, he has attended as a guest, often collaborating with top designers. His absence tonight, however, suggests he may be choosing to keep his personal life away from the flashiest of red carpets—at least for now.

Broader Trends at the Met Gala 2026: A Night of Solo Stars and Surprise Guests

While Kardashian and Hamilton dominated pre-Gala headlines, the actual carpet was filled with other notable moments. NASCAR driver Carson Hocevar became the first driver from his sport to attend the Met Gala since Jeff Gordon in 2010. Hocevar, who won his first Cup Series race at Talladega just weeks ago, appeared on the official E! stream. “I'm confident racing and putting a race suit on, but when I put this suit on, it's hard for me to get this confident,” he said. His presence signaled a growing crossover between motorsports and high fashion, a space Hamilton has helped to define.
